ACEYX vs. FHKCX
ACEYX (AB All China Equity Portfolio) and FHKCX (Fidelity China Region Fund) are both China Equities funds. Over the past 5 years, ACEYX returned -2.67%/yr vs 9.09%/yr for FHKCX. Their correlation of 0.86 suggests significant overlap in exposure. ACEYX charges 1.25%/yr vs 0.91%/yr for FHKCX.

ACEYX vs. FHKCX - Yearly Performance Comparison
| 2026 (YTD) | 2025 | 2024 | 2023 | 2022 | 2021 | 2020 | 2019 | 2018 |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
ACEYX AB All China Equity Portfolio | 0.89% | 33.91% | 17.44% | -10.96% | -26.65% | -14.65% | 25.38% | 37.67% | -21.60% |
FHKCX Fidelity China Region Fund | 39.90% | 42.56% | 23.15% | -0.29% | -23.87% | -13.69% | 47.85% | 35.12% | -17.48% |

Drawdowns
ACEYX vs. FHKCX - Drawdown Comparison
The maximum ACEYX drawdown since its inception was -57.58%, smaller than the maximum FHKCX drawdown of -61.96%. Use the drawdown chart below to compare losses from any high point for ACEYX and FHKCX.
Loading charts...
Drawdown Indicators
| ACEYX | FHKCX | Difference | |
|---|---|---|---|
Max DrawdownLargest peak-to-trough decline | -57.58% | -61.96% | +4.38% |
Max Drawdown (1Y)Largest decline over 1 year | -14.14% | -10.80% | -3.34% |
Max Drawdown (3Y)Largest decline over 3 years | -21.83% | -22.02% | +0.19% |
Max Drawdown (5Y)Largest decline over 5 years | -51.02% | -52.42% | +1.40% |
Max Drawdown (10Y)Largest decline over 10 years | — | -58.41% | — |
Current DrawdownCurrent decline from peak | -25.16% | 0.00% | -25.16% |
Average DrawdownAverage peak-to-trough decline | -27.76% | -20.26% | -7.50% |
Ulcer IndexDepth and duration of drawdowns from previous peaks | 5.41% | 3.48% | +1.93% |
